Output 69c69691ba982a7b58259da710ec55447a4dc8334dd25afb7b00b973eeaf5ff4:1

value
666134981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 604904ff5d83caae931a0f80a31f108965706f1f OP_EQUAL
address
3AU8GSkUuqfXT6qtx7LHYpJGv59Rt8EGYq
transaction
69c69691ba982a7b58259da710ec55447a4dc8334dd25afb7b00b973eeaf5ff4
spent
true